Every seven years, UPVC and composite doors need to be replaced
Composite doors and UPVC are an affordable way to secure your home. The materials are sturdy and stylish. But which one is right for your home? There are a lot of factors to consider prior to making your final choice.
UPVC and composite doors are both constructed from a variety of materials. They are made by using high pressure to make them tough and durable. uPVC is a strong and hard material. Composite is a blend of glass reinforced plastic and a variety of other materials.
Each door is insulated to block the exchange of heat between your home's exterior and interior. However, the composite material has a higher density and is more efficient thermally than uPVC. This helps you lower your heating bills.
Composite doors are more expensive that uPVC, but they offer numerous advantages. They are energy efficient and durable, as well as virtually maintenance-free. Doors are also available in different designs, colors, and styles.
Depending on upvc window repairs near me of door you chooseto install, you can anticipate a life expectation of 20-25 or more. Composite doors provide a greater life expectancy and are the best option if you want to save money. They can last for up to 30 years and require only minimal maintenance.
uPVC doors are made by encasing an insulated steel frame within unplasticised polyvinyl chloride. They are very durable but less robust than composite doors. They are more sturdy and have a plasticky exterior. They have a very high degree of security as they aren't prone to denting and twisting.

Windows made of rotted wood
The presence of rotten wood windows is an issue that is very serious, but there are several options to repair them. It is necessary to replace your sill or vertical board and possibly the glass, but repair of the window isn't impossible.
Wood filler can be a good option to eliminate wood rot, but it's not an ideal long-term solution. Instead, you should seek out an experienced carpenter.
Water damage can cause wood to rot. The good news is, windows can appear brand new by replacing the damaged or rotten wood with a custom insert. Painting and sealing cedar homes made of wood is a must.
The traditional method is to contact a local carpenter. They will be able to inform you precisely what the issue is and how to fix it.
Another good option is to use Bondo All-Purpose Putty. It is specifically designed to repair windows that have become damaged, but it also works well on other surfaces. It is simple to apply and forms a hard, durable surface.
To get the most value from wood fillers you'll have to remove all the rotted wood. While a prybar is an excellent tool to do this, you may need to use either a hammer, or chisel. After you have eliminated the majority of the rot, you are able to begin the repair.
You can also use epoxy to stop the rot in a pinch. This kind of filler isn't an alternative to a brand new frame. It can be used for small patches, but you'll need another option if your damage is substantial.
Paint your windows is a good way to protect the wood from moisture. This will help to reduce the sound of draughts and rattles. If you decide to paint your windows, make sure to use a product that is specifically for use on exteriors.

Secure an opening or window
Windows that are locked and secured can help make your home more secure. It will increase your property's security and give you peace-of-mind.
Installing the window bar is a great option to secure your window. The bars can be constructed from wood or bought. These bars are affordable and can provide protection for your windows.
Security film can be used to secure windows. It is a thin vinyl sheet that adheres to the glass, and will keep crooks from getting access to the lock. The film will also keep the glass in place and make it harder for intruders.
Double-paned windows are much more difficult to break. These windows are great to save energy. They do make windows susceptible to leaks. Gas pockets in between the panes may cause this. If the seal of these pockets is compromised the gas may cause condensation between the panes.
You can also opt for security screens. These are like bug screens but are designed to make them more difficult to break through. These screens are designed to fit over existing windowpanes , and are difficult to break through.
Another option to secure windows is to install an additional lock. There are two options such as a commercial key lock or a simple door-andwindow sensor. This will offer a greater amount of security, and could be the best choice for your window.
